Switch Player Magazine might not be one of the titles from our Fusion stable, but it’s always sad to see a games magazine close, even if it’s a magazine from another publisher. This is because a healthy independent games mag scene is a good thing for everybody, readers, writers and publishers alike.
For this reason, we were saddened to hear that Ninty Media’s bimonthly title Switch Player Magazine will be closing after its next issue (issue 69).
Switch Player Magazine’s publisher Ninty Media have also published books and several issues of their cross-generation Nintendo magazine Ninty Fresh, and they promise to return with more Nintendo coverage in print.
As There are no longer any dedicated Nintendo magazines on UK newsstands, the mail-order-only Switch Player Magazine really filled a gap in the market. We look forward to seeing what the Ninty Media team come up with next.
